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0999303830 26 771656 486272550 70903497
918606 1680 655
918606 1680 655
52 424676296 77337492297
All about undefined
Interested in learning more?
918606 1680 655
52 424676296 77337492297
See more
57393194868 3641073895
830 50153904 02170 34811485 026
See more
9762738131 151
25 66 86358182211 3552183
See more